So yesterday I dragged myself out of the house for long enough to see a movie.

I was going to see Brotherhood of the Wolf and Monster's Ball, but by the end of Wolf I was emotionally exhausted and staggered off home. You really can't see two movies in a day when one of them is Brotherhood of the Wolf, and not only because it's 2 1/2 hours long.

It's quite a film, actually, to riff on the joke in every single review, it's about the best French / period / martial arts / horror / political / gore / romance / mystery / adventure film I've ever seen. I just sat there saying, "Okay, gimme the kitchen sink!" because certainly everything else was in that movie.

There's something for everyone--gorgeous men leaping around like salmon (o that Indian!), stunning women with perfect breasts, there's even a sex scene with blood for me!

There are also about four false endings, which gets a little old after awhile, but mostly it's just quite a romp.

I'd have to say that the only thing that I didn't entirely enjoy was the woman who sat next to me and immediately fell asleep and snored, waking up every so often to watch a few minutes through slitted eyes, then immediately fall back asleep again, though I must say that I did find it entertaining to imagine what she thought of the movie. It's peculiar enough when you watch the whole thing in a row, it must have seemed like a dream gone amok when watched in small slivers.
